
When your Pluto lands in someone else's 1st house in synastry, you can almost guarantee the first meeting will be anything but boring. This placement introduces an undeniable charge to the air, like you've both stepped onto a stage and the spotlight won't turn off. Pluto is the planet of transformation, power, and deep psychological forces, while the 1st house is all about personal identity and the face you show the world. When these two realms collide, sparks fly—and sometimes, so do egos.
You, as the Pluto person, might feel an uncanny pull toward the 1st house person's very essence. It's as if their personality, the way they move, dress, or even raise an eyebrow, awakens something primal within you. Meanwhile, the 1st house person will sense your attention almost immediately. There's a feeling of being seen on a level that is equal parts exhilarating and intense, a bit like someone x-raying your soul while complimenting your haircut.
Relationship dynamics under this synastry are rarely shallow. The Pluto person often acts as a catalyst for the 1st house person's self-discovery, for better or worse. You might find yourself pushing them to confront hidden fears or embrace sides of themselves they've kept under wraps. Sometimes this inspires tremendous growth and confidence. Other times, it can feel like you're a cosmic personal trainer who forgot to ask about rest days.
Emotionally, this can be a rollercoaster. The 1st house person may feel simultaneously empowered and exposed, alternately loving and resenting the intensity you bring. You, as Pluto, may sometimes cross the line between fascination and obsession, so it's important to keep your X-ray vision set to 'low' when needed. Practically, this dynamic can manifest as passionate debates, dramatic makeovers, or joint ventures that challenge comfort zones.
Attraction is practically a given here. There's often a magnetic, almost hypnotic quality to your connection. Communication can be deep and revealing, with conversations that cut straight to the heart of the matter. Shared activities tend to revolve around transformation and reinvention—think yoga retreats, therapy sessions, or even binge-watching documentaries about phoenixes rising from ashes.
The strengths of this placement lie in its power to foster genuine change and mutual fascination. If you channel the energy wisely, you can help each other break free from old patterns and become truer versions of yourselves. However, the challenge comes in maintaining balance. The Pluto person must avoid becoming too controlling or critical of the 1st house person's choices. The 1st house individual, in turn, should strive to assert their boundaries and communicate openly about their needs.
To make the most of Pluto in the 1st house synastry, remember that transformation is a team sport. Encourage one another to grow, but respect each other's process and autonomy. Humor helps too—sometimes you just have to laugh at the cosmic plot twists that come your way. If you can keep the passion without losing your individuality, this placement can be one of the most empowering bonds you'll ever experience.
